Faucet rep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to residential and commercial faucets. Technicians evaluate the plumbing components to identify problems such as leaks, drips, low water pressure, or difficulty turning the handle. Repairs may include replacing worn-out washers, seals, or cartridges, tightening loose parts, or fixing damaged valves. The goal is to restore proper function and prevent water wastage, ensuring the faucet operates smoothly and efficiently.

Professional faucet repair providers are equipped to handle different faucet styles, such as compression, cartridge, ball, or ceramic disc faucets. They are skilled at working with various plumbing configurations found in properties of different ages and designs. The overview below groups typical Faucet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bridgewater,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Faucet Repair - Typically costs between $100 and $300 for common repairs such as fixing leaks or replacing washers. The total may vary depending on the faucet type and complexity of the issue.

Handle Replacement - Replacing a faucet handle generally ranges from $75 to $200, including parts and labor. Costs depend on the faucet brand and whether additional components are needed.

Valve Repair or Replacement - Repairing or replacing internal valves can range from $150 to $400, depending on the valve type and accessibility. More complex cases may incur higher costs.

Full Faucet Replacement - Installing a new faucet typically costs between $200 and $600, including parts and labor. The price varies based on faucet style and installation difficulty.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
